Abstract

The utility model discloses an audio test fixture with multiple tests, which comprises a fixture base, a test product and a fixture cover plate; the jig base is provided with an audio test block, and the audio test block is provided with more than one test product fixing clamping groove; more than one audio test probe is arranged in the test product fixing clamping groove, more than one product audio test PAD is arranged on the test product, the test product is arranged in the test product fixing clamping groove, and the audio test probe arranged in the test product fixing clamping groove corresponds to the product audio test PAD arranged on the test product. Audio test fixture capable of testing multiple audio signals
Technical Field
The utility model relates to an audio test fixture, concretely relates to audio test fixture that one surveys many.
Background
The existing audio test equipment can only test 1 MIC at one time, and can only save board taking and placing time even if an automatic conversion device is arranged, so that the test time cannot be short, the test time is too long, the efficiency is low, and the test time is usually 100 pcs/h.

As shown in fig. 1-3, the utility model discloses an audio test fixture with one test and multiple tests, which comprises a fixture base 1, a test product 2 and a fixture cover plate 3;
an audio test block 4 is arranged on the jig base 1, and the audio test block 4 is provided with more than one test product fixing clamping groove 5; more than one audio test probe 6 is arranged in the test product fixing clamping groove 5, more than one product audio test PAD7 is arranged on the test product 2, the test product 2 is arranged in the test product fixing clamping groove 5, and the audio test probe 6 arranged in the test product fixing clamping groove 5 corresponds to the product audio test PAD7 arranged on the test product 2; the jig cover plate 3 is provided with a cover plate boss 8, the cover plate boss 8 is provided with more than one product fixing boss 9, and the product fixing boss 9 on the cover plate boss 8 corresponds to the test product fixing clamping groove 5 on the jig base 1; the jig cover plate 3 is arranged above the jig base 1; a plurality of sound cards are integrated on a main board, synchronous work is carried out, the jig is made into multiple modes, synchronous testing of multiple MICs is achieved, and multi-channel synchronous detection is detected through single-channel switching.
In this embodiment, positioning pins 10 are disposed around the jig base 1, cover plate positioning holes 11 are disposed around the jig cover plate 3, and the jig cover plate 3 is mounted on the positioning pins 10 of the jig base 1 through the cover plate positioning holes 11.
In this embodiment, the audio test block 4 is provided with an audio test block fixing screw 12, and the audio test block 4 is mounted on the jig base 1 through the audio test block fixing screw 12; the cover plate boss 8 is provided with a cover plate boss positioning screw 13, and the cover plate boss 8 is installed on the jig cover plate 3 through the cover plate boss positioning screw 13.
